Sorry to be talking so much but Bamsen i saw your review of HARMONIA's live album and enjoyed it so re-visited their "Deluxe" album which was their final studio record and had to bump it up to 4 stars.I can hear why this is listed under Electronic but it's cool to have Mani from GURU GURU play on some tracks.That's a fun album to listen to.The two CLUSTER dudes plus Rother from NEU! make such a good team.

Say, does anyone know of other albums comparable to In Den Garten Pharaos? I've been really into dark, droning, pulsing kraut like that lately.
I haven't found anything else I consider on the same level as Pharaos Although, one thing I've just discovered that is very cool is Mittelwinternacht '71 ![]() Edited by Triceratopsoil - November 06 2011 at 23:41 |
||
![]() |
||
Guldbamsen ![]() Special Collaborator ![]() ![]() Retired Admin Joined: January 22 2009 Location: Magic Theatre Status: Offline Points: 23104 |
![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() |
|
Errmm - that Popol Vuh album is really one of a kind, and that is probably what makes it so special, but Affenstunde - their debut comes pretty close to it soundwise. Other Krautrock acts that fiddle within droning textures and the surreal are these: Between: Tony Conrad(here with Faust): Cluster: Lard Free: Deuter: And if you want something that´s droning, distorted and evil - mixed up with a healthy dose of black metal, then maybe Aluk Todolo is right up your alley. Not for everyone though: Edited by Guldbamsen - November 07 2011 at 17:50 |
